

Lion's Den
Julia, a 25 year-old university student, two weeks pregnant, with no criminal record, is sent to prison. Julia murdered the father of her child. This story addresses maternity, jail and Justice; confinement, guilt and solitude; but above all it deals with Julia and her son, Tomas, born inside an Argentinean prison.

About Lion's Den
Lion's Den is a 2008 Spanish-language drama film directed by Pablo Trapero. The cast is led by Martina Gusmán, Elli Medeiros, Rodrigo Santoro. It has a runtime of 1h 53m. Lion's Den cast & crew
Lion's Den was directed by Pablo Trapero and written by Pablo Trapero, Santiago Mitre, and Martín Mauregui.
The cast features Martina Gusmán as Julia, Elli Medeiros as Sofia, Rodrigo Santoro as Ramiro, Laura García as Marta, Tomás Plotinsky as Tomás VI, and Leonardo Sauma as Ugo Casman.
Behind the camera, cinematography is by Guillermo Nieto and it was produced by Suh Young-joo and Martina Gusmán.
